> Hi,
> I have an application loaded on my windows XP machine that does
> something that frustrates me. Upon starting the application it
> creates a "new folder" under "My Documents", this is the location
> of the folder that the application will store all files that I
> create. Once the application has started I have the option under
> "preferences" to change the location for these files, the problem
> is that it still creates this "default folder" under "My Documents"
> even though it no longer writes into it (i.e. it uses the new
> location I created under 'preferences').
>
> My question is simply - How do I stop this action ?
>
> I have tried scanning thru the registry looking for the path "F:\My
> Documents\Video capture" as this is the folder it creates but I
> cannot see it, I can see in the registry the new path I created
> from within the application.
Ask the creator of said application.
It is the one creating the folder - and other than cheesy permissions tricks
that would cause more issues than you probably want to --> they are the ones
that have to not do this.
